Iran plans to export 2M tons of caviar

‬Baku, Azerbaijan, Apr.28

By Fatih Karimov - Trend: Iran plans to export about 2 million metric tons of caviar in the current Iranian fiscal year, which began on March 21, said Hassan Salehi, the head of Iran 's Fishery Organization.

Last year, about 600 metric tons of sturgeon fish and 1,200 kilograms of caviar were produced in the country, he said, adding that about one metric ton of caviar was exported,Iran 's Mehr news agency reported April 28.

He also said that the Caspian Sea states may extend an agreement to ban hunting sturgeon fish by 2020.

In July, heads of fishery organizations of Iran, Azerbaijan, Russia, Kazakhstan, and Turkmenistan will meet in Russia to discuss the issue, he noted.

They agreed in Baku in 2010 to ban hunting sturgeon fish for five years and the agreement will be likely extended for other five years, he added.

Iranian caviar is exported to European countries, Caspian Sea states, Persian Gulf states, and the US.

Iran Fisheries Organization's Director for Caviar Affairs Mahmoud Assadollahi said in October 2013 that Iran currently produces less than 20 metric tons of wild caviar annually.

"If the illegal fishing continues, Iran 's wild caviar fish would become extinct in eight years," he said.
